Virginia Certificate of Birth #58820 was recorded 13 May 1957. It shows Roy Mitchell Lotts was born on 23 Sept 1913 in Walkers Creek, Rockbridge Co., VA to farmer John William Lotts and Rachel Sweet. He was their 8th child. His parents were also born in Rockbridge Co., VA. His aunt Daisy Kesterman certified this data.
ON the 1930 Walkers Creek, Rockbridge Co., VA census, I found farmer John W Lotts, 57; wife Rachel, 58; son Thomas J, 26; daughter Bessie E, 18 and son Roy E, 16, all VA born.
His unidentified local obit says: Roy M. Lotts. Roy "Mitchel" Lotts, 78, of HCR 32, Box 15, Middlebrook, died at 11 p.m. Saturday (Oct. 10, 1992) in Liberty House Nursing Home, Waynesboro. He was born Sept. 23, "1914," in Rockbridge County, a son of the late John Thomas and Rachel Sweet Lotts. Mr. Lotts was a member of New Providence Presbyterian Church and for 15 years was caretaker for the church cemetery. He was the retired owner of Lotts Custom Slaughter, Newport. He was preceded in death by his wife, Hazel Stockdale Gladwell Lotts; and one grandson. Survivors include two sons, David M. Lotts of Middlebrook and William P. Gladwell Lotts of Waynesboro; one daughter Mrs. Mary Glenn Davis of Middlebrook; one sister, Mrs. Bessie L. Kirby of Glasgow; 10 grandchildren; and nine great-grandchildren. A service will be conducted at 11 a.m. Tuesday in the New Providence Presbyterian Church by Dr. John H. H. Lewis and the Rev. Thomas Biggs. Burial will follow in the church cemetery. Active pallbearers will be grandsons and nephews. The family will receive friends from 7:30 to 9 p.m. today in the Henry Funeral Home and other times at the residence.
Source of burial here: Rockbridge County, Virginia Cemeteries, South River and Walker Creek Districts, by the Rockbridge Area Genealogical Society, 1999, page 164.
